Pat - 03 Sep 2004 02:53 GMT
Gloria went on vacation last Friday morning and left me in charge of the 16
horses, the two dogs she left behind, and her cats, Leap-in-the-Air and
Tubs.

Tubs is a big solid gray boy. He lived here with me for several months when
he was a kitten and is the same age as Baby Eyes. It was after he decided to
go back to Gloria's to live that I adopted Tommy, Abelard and Eli. Tubs
hasn't been near my house in more than three years, even when Gloria has
been gone for longer times, but this time he is getting lonely. Last night,
he was in my driveway.

When I went out to collect Tommy and Eli before I went to bed, and they were
having in yowling match with Tubs. There must have been at least one close
encounter, because today Eli has a Roman nose.
